目的 探讨与 bcl-2翻译起始部位碱基互补的反义 bcl-2寡脱氧核苷酸 ( oligodeoxynucleotide,ODN)对 Bca-CD885细胞内源性 bcl-2表达的阻断作用。方法 以脂质体 Lepofectin为载体 ,一过性转染 2 0 μmol/L 反义及正义 bcl-2 ODN于 Bca CD885细胞中 ,FCM-抗体观测转染后 2 4h、3 6h、48h细胞内 bcl-2基因蛋白表达变化 ,RT-PCR技术检测转染后 2 4h bcl-2 m RNA的表达变化。结果 转染反义 bcl-2 ODN后 2 4h、3 6h、48h Bca CD885细胞内 bcl-2基因蛋白表达与对照组相比都明显下降 ( P<0 .0 5 ) ,而正义组与对照组无差异 ( P>0 .0 5 ) ;正反义组 bcl-2m RNA与对照组相比无明显变化 ( P>0 .0 5 )。结论 反义 bcl-2 ODN能在蛋白翻译水平特异性抑制颊癌细胞内源性 bcl-2蛋白表达
OBJECTIVE: To investigate the effect of antisense bcl-2 oligodeoxynucleotide (ODN) complementary to the translation initiation site of bcl-2 on the endogenous bcl-2 expression in Bca-CD885 cells. Methods Liposomes Lepofectin was used as a vector and transiently transfected with 20 μmol / L antisense and sense bcl-2 ODN in Bca CD885 cells. FCM-antibody was used to observe the expression of bcl-2 at 24 h, 36 h and 48 h after transfection -2 gene protein expression was detected by RT-PCR technology 24h after transfection bcl-2mRNA expression changes. Results Compared with control group, the expression of bcl-2 protein in Bca CD885 cells decreased significantly (P <0.05) at 24 h, 36 h and 48 h after transfection with antisense bcl-2 ODN, while the expression of bcl- There was no difference (P> 0.05). The bcl-2 mRNA in the antisense and antisense groups showed no significant difference compared with the control group (P> 0.05). Conclusion Antisense bcl-2 ODN can specifically inhibit the expression of endogenous bcl-2 protein in buccal carcinoma cells at the level of protein translation
